[Bug 378400] Re: Thinkpad T61p cannot resume from suspend

2013-02-07 Thread xor
I'm on Kubuntu12.10 amd64 using a Thinkpad T61p with the proprietary NVIDIA 
drivers and the issue still is present.
I am willing to help debugging this, I am a developer myself so I can follow 
complex instructions.

Suspend works very well, but hibernation does not.

What does work is writing the hibernation file to disk and turning the device 
off.
What does NOT work is resuming from the hibernation file.

The kernel will print the screen which shows the progress of loading the 
hibernation data.
After it has finished, a blank screen will appear.

I tried using pm-hibernate from a text-mode terminal, i.e. I switched from the 
X server to the terminal with CTRL+ALT+F1.
After resuming from hibernation, I tried to switch back to the terminal with 
CTRL+ALT+F1 which did not work at first.
 I randomly pressed all keys on the keyboard and then tried to switch back to 
the terminal again with CTRL+ALT+F1 which DID work.
What showed was that the pm-hibernate program had NOT exited yet, i.e. there 
was no terminal prompt after it.

Then I was able to switch to the other terminals, however they did hang
after I typed the username and tried to enter the password.

[Bug 378400] Re: Thinkpad T61p cannot resume from suspend

2013-02-07 Thread xor
Further Google investigation showed that after 2 minutes of waiting for
the system to resume from hibernation, a part of the kernel will crash
due to a timeout and the system WILL be useable.

I've attached the related tail of /var/log/kern.log
